Okkotsu Yuuta is a nervous high school student suffering from a serious problem—his childhood love Rika has turned into a curse and won't leave him alone. Since Rika's no ordinary curse, his plight is noticed by Gojou Satoru, a teacher at Jujutsu Technical School, a school where fledgling exorcists learn how to combat curses. Gojou convinces Yuuta to enroll, but can he learn enough in time to confront the curse that haunts him? (Edited VIZ) The official predecessor miniseries to Gege Akutami's hit serialization, *Jujutsu Kaisen*!

Rosalind Hathaway, an adorable 8-year-old girl with rosy cheeks and golden hair. Apparently fair and kind, a little angel in society's eyes. And yet her appearance hides a dark secret, for wherever she goes, death follows. **Note:** This manga was originally published in 1973. In the 2017 reprint, the author released a new chapter 44 years after the original release. This extra chapter is a prequel to the events of the manga.

In this 10 volume official Touhou series, spanning the time period of nine long years between the UFO and WBaWC games, we follow the misadventures of the business inept shrine maiden Reimu Hakurei and her ever-curious friend Marisa Kirisame, who meet a mysterious, young hermit woman named Ibara Kasen. Upon seeing how sloppily the Hakurei Shrine conducts its business, she decides to become a regular shrine visitor, determined to lend her near unlimited wisdom to the shrine maiden, in order to make her place a proper Shinto Shrine. Does the nagging, yet well meaning hermit bring nothing but good-will with her advice, or is there something more sinister hiding behind the friendly face and her bandaged arm?
